Digital Signal Processing Laboratory -Exercises in TMS320C67



Integrates DSP theory with practical hardware/software applications
# Contains problems and exercises, along with tutorials for designing software models and using hardware
# Covers basic concepts, such as Z-transform, system function, discrete-time convolution, and difference equations
# Reviews sampling, quantization (uniform and non-uniform), and binary encoding in the PCM process
# Includes appendices that give detailed hardware descriptions, user instructions for the equipment described in the text, and brief descriptions of alternate equipment and manufacturers
# Provides numerous homework problems, case studies, and examplesSolutions Manual available with qualifying course adoptions

Given the rapid software and hardware developments in DSP, it is vital for students to complement their theoretical learning with practical applications. Digital Signal Processing Laboratory is a practical, readily understandable text for those studying DSP for the first time. The author acquaints students with an integrated approach consisting of side-by-side training in theory and hardware/software aspects of DSP, making it ideal for the companion laboratory to a class in DSP theory.

To execute this approach, each chapter consists of a brief section on theory to explain the underlying mathematics and principles, a problem solving section, and a computer laboratory section with programming examples and exercises using MATLAB and Simulink. Applicable chapters include a hardware laboratory section composed of exercises using test and measuring equipment. The author discusses the theory of DSP applications and systems, LTI discrete-time signals and systems, practical time and frequency analysis of discrete-time signals, Analog-to-Digital (A/D) process, design and application of digital filters, and the application of practical DSP processes through the DSP hardware, along with software models of these systems.

This textbook/lab manual offers a concise, easily understood presentation that makes the information accessible to senior undergraduate and graduate students while building their proficiency with the software, the hardware, and the theory of DSP. Students can easily adapt the concepts for different software/hardware conditions than those presented within, making this an extremely versatile and valuable resource.

A cell phone’s roaming feature allows the user to get service when traveling beyond the boundaries of his/her service provider. Wireless service providers make approximately 30% of their operating profit from roaming. But despite being a major source of income, roaming suffers from a number of technological problems in the handoff between networks. Signal strength is wildly variable, calls are frequently dropped, and quality of service is poor. Based upon training courses the author teaches at Agilent and Hewlett-Packard, this is the first book to give communications engineers the know-how to faultlessly design and manage roaming services.

AN INTRODUCTION TO STEPPER MOTORS


Square 1 Electronics' new book, "Easy Step'n", An Introduction to Stepper Motors for the Experimenter," explains to the reader how to determine surplus motor electrical and mechanical specs by using easy-to-build electrical and mechanical test equipment. The experimenter will learn to design and build microcontroller based control systems and to design and build driver circuits to switch power applied to stepper motor windings. The book is hands-on and full of experiments. The format of the books uses flow charts and many code examples in a step-by-step approach.
